Add an Alert

Prev Next

Who can use this feature?

System Administrators | Owners | Publishers | Authors

Instructions

  1. Click the Modules drop-down The dropdown labeled Modules.

  2. Click the Content tab The left-hand tab labeled Content.

  3. Click Alert Center The URL labeled Alet Center.

  4. Select the category you would like the alert to be under A category in the All Categories column.

  5. Select Add Alert The button labeled Add Alert.

  6. Fill in the information The text entry fields and options to Add an Alert.

    Note: Leaving “Emergency Alert” does not override the alert bar text; only custom text will override the alert bar text.

      • Title: Title of the alert

      • Brief Description: Brief description of the alert; you are limited to 250 characters

      • Full Description: The full description of the alert

      • Alert Bar: Choose if you would like the alert to display in the Alert Bar on no pages, All Pages, Only, or a Department page and subpages

        Note: This option will only be available if the Alert Bar is enabled for the category. Only 2 alerts will show in the alert bar.

        Selecting the Department page and subpages will allow site visitors on a specific Department's pages to see department-specific information in the Alert Bar rather than seeing the same alert added for All Pages. Department-specific alerts will always take precedence over All Pages alerts, ensuring that two alerts can be published on the Alert Bar and All Pages without preventing any Department-specific Alert Bar content.

      • Alert Bar Text: Add a name to appear on the Alert Bar.

      • Alert Bar Link: List the link that directs clicks on the Alert Bar.

        Note: Leaving “/AlertCenter.aspx” does not override the alert bar link; only a custom relative or absolute link will change where the main Alert Bar area directs.

      • Upload Image(s): Add related photos to the alert

      • “Read On…” Text: Determine how the link will be displayed if there is a Full Description

      • Link(s): Add related links regarding this alert; click the + to the right of the Display Text to add additional links The plus sign icon to the right of the Dipslay Text field.

      • Open in New Window: The link opens a new window

      • Link item, image, read on, RSS, and notifications to this Web Address: "Read On..." text link will direct to this link rather than the alert item screen on widgets or the Alert Bar The toggle labeled Link item, image, read on, R S S and notifications to this Web Address.

        Note: This can only be enabled on a single link. This option will be disabled for any other links once it is selected.

      • Alert Starts: alert will display on the front end of the website

      • Alert Ends: When the alert will end on the front end of the website

  7. Choose a saving option The button labeled Save and the button labeled Save and Publish.

    • Save Changes: Will save any changes you have made to the file

    • Save & Publish: Will save the changes and publish them to the live site

    • Save & Submit: Will save the changes and submit them for approval (authors only)

    • Cancel: Will delete what you have done

  8. A notification window will open; your options to send the notification include: The text entry fields and options in the pop-up labeled Alert Center.

    • Subject: Add a brief subject line

    • Comments: Attach a description of the alert

    • Mobile Text/Push Message: Attach a message to the SMS notification

    • Include link to item: Provides a link to the item within the SMS message, which the user can visit via their mobile device

    • Send

      • On Start Date: Sends the item on the start date previously set

      • Immediately: Sends the immediately

    • Select Send, Don’t Send, or Cancel: The notification will then send accordingly to those who have signed up in Notify Me for the selected Alert Center category
